dc.descriptionThree integrable models - the deformed Heisenberg, Landau - Lifschits and Ishimori magnets are written in terms of the stereographic projection. The Hamiltonians of these models are obtained and certain questions related to the existence of exact solutions are studied. In particular, the stability of solitions is studied for the Heisenberg marnet, simplest stationary solutions are obtained for the Landau - Lifschits magnet, and Hamiltonians and topological charges are calculated for several known solutions of the Ishimori model
